What I Check Before I Buy

Before I choose a blueberry creamer, I always look at a few important details. I check the flavor strength, sweetness level, ingredients, and whether it is dairy or non-dairy. I also pay attention to how well it blends with hot coffee, since some creamers can separate or taste artificial.

Flavor Quality

The first thing I care about is taste. I prefer a blueberry flavor that feels smooth and natural rather than too candy-like. If the blueberry note is too strong, it can take over the coffee. If it is too weak, I barely notice it. I usually look for a creamer that gives a balanced fruity flavor with a creamy finish.

Ingredients I Prefer

I always read the ingredient list carefully. If I want a richer taste, I may choose a creamer with real dairy ingredients. If I want something lighter or lactose-free, I look for plant-based options. I also try to avoid products with too many artificial additives when I can, because I find simpler ingredient lists more appealing.

Sweetness Level

Sweetness matters a lot to me. Some blueberry creamers taste more like dessert syrup than coffee creamer, and that can be too much for my daily cup. I usually prefer a product that is lightly sweetened so I can still taste the coffee underneath. If I want more sweetness, I can always add it myself.

Texture and Mixability

I like a creamer that blends smoothly into both hot and iced coffee. A good blueberry creamer should make the coffee creamy without leaving an oily film or clumps. I notice that better-quality creamers mix more evenly and give the drink a consistent texture from the first sip to the last.

Dairy vs. Non-Dairy Options

I decide between dairy and non-dairy based on my needs and preferences. Dairy creamers often taste richer, while non-dairy ones can be easier on the stomach and work well for people avoiding milk. I personally choose based on how creamy I want the coffee to feel and whether I need a lactose-free option.

Calories and Nutrition

If I drink flavored coffee often, I pay attention to calories, sugar, and fat content. Some blueberry creamers are indulgent and higher in sugar, while others are designed to be lighter. I try to pick one that fits my routine so I can enjoy it without feeling like I am overdoing it.

Packaging and Storage

I also consider how easy the creamer is to store and use. Bottled creamers are convenient for my fridge, while powdered versions can last longer in the pantry. I prefer packaging that pours cleanly and keeps the product fresh, especially if I do not use it every day.

Best Use Cases

In my experience, blueberry creamer works best in medium or light roast coffee because the fruity flavor stands out more. I also enjoy it in iced coffee, where the flavor feels refreshing. If I want a cozy treat, I use it in a warm cup with a little whipped cream on top.
